WATCH: Zach Harrison’s mom gets captain reveal phone call for her son

We’ve been following some of the phone calls to Ohio State football parents, informing them that their sons were voted captains for the 2021 season. First, we shared the phone call to Thayer Munford’s mom, then an emotional reaction by Teradja Mitchell’s dad, and now this one.

Zach Harrison is from the Columbus area, so he and his mom no doubt know how important it is to be voted captain at THE Ohio State University. He’s one of only six this season, and he should be poised for a breakout campaign in 2021.

We always say it, but being a captain at OSU can never be taken away, and it opens the doors for other opportunities down the road to congregate and come back to the university to be recognized.

Watch and listen to Harrison’s mother get the phone call from assistant coach Larry Johnson, revealing that he will be a leader on the team this season. We especially love the response about what a responsibility it is. Always a mom.

Remember, Harrison was a five-star prospect that shunned Michigan to come to Ohio State and was expected to be the next great pass rusher off the edge in Columbus. Could this be the year he puts it all together?
